Sales Manager
Philadelphia, PA
Full Time
Wurzak Hotel Group is seeking a results driven Sales Manager to drive our Sales efforts at our gorgeous Hilton City Ave Philadelphia just minutes from Center City. With 35,000 square feet of recently renovated flexible meeting and banquet space and 207 renovated guest rooms, this property is tremendous opportunity for the right candidate.
As Sales Manager, you’ll take full ownership of your market segment—developing and nurturing business opportunities from initial contact to contract close. You’ll blend data-driven strategy with hospitality flair to exceed goals and enhance the guest experience.

Who We Are
Wurzak Hotel Group (WHG) is a Philadelphia-based owner, developer, and operator of premium branded full-service, extended stay, and focus service hotels. WHG’s core expertise is its unique ability to develop and operate hotels and food and beverage outlets in an entrepreneurial manner maximizing returns on the investment and developing long-term relationships with our guests.
WHG has earned and maintains its competitive advantage by developing talent within the organization who embody the same entrepreneurial spirit of our leadership team and who seek to create value through tireless innovation, tight focus on the operational details, and uncompromised guest satisfaction. Wurzak Hotel Group has a proven track record of developing and managing hospitality assets for over 30 years and continues to be recognized as one of the region’s top hospitality companies.
